Placement Specialist

Marsh is seeking candidates for our open Placement Specialist position in our Seattle, Houston, New York City or Chicago office. This is a hybrid role that has a requirement of working at least three days a week in the office.

What can you expect:

  • Builds and maintains relationships with underwriters, and is involved in the placement of sophisticated insurance programs.
  • Helps identify the need for new products and develops innovative solutions for clients.
  • Completes policy management activities and delivery of reviewed policy to client and helps address client inquiries as necessary.
  • Delivers technical expertise in the delivery and presentation or marine portions of RFP's.

We will count on you to:

  • Manage and monitor the insured's placement strategy by utilizing risk expertise and knowledge of industry and carriers to develop placement solutions that meet complex client needs.
  • Develop methods for the go-to-market strategy and provide input on pricing of services supporting client retention and new business production.
  • Guide strong working relations with carriers and/or underwriters to create innovative approaches to unique client needs and provide cohesive client service.
  • Audit and finalize commission structure with underwriter in accordance with client direction, Marsh Commission Yield Statements and Facility agreements.
  • Achieve a thorough understanding of changing insurance, risk market conditions, and inform client teams, clients and carriers of major developments affecting various types of coverage.
  • Advanced knowledge to the firm's product lines by active participation in internal networks.
  • Devise new products and innovative solutions that address complex client needs.
  • Lead complex placement/technical support activities on big accounts, such as ensuring procedural compliance, reviewing data and updating annual renewal exhibits, maintaining accurate placement system entries, to ensure contract execution as required.
  • Consult management on highly complex client issues or trends through clear and concise communication that drives development.
  • Develop strong working relations with carriers and/or underwriters. Submit coverage specifications and obtain quotes from carriers, ensure that coverage is bound and be responsible for the accuracy of bound programs. Receive and analyze quotes from carriers and provide analysis and recommendations.

What you need to have:

  • 5+ years industry experience
  • Commercial Brokerage and/or Underwriting Experience preferably in marine lines of coverage
  • P&C license a must, or ability to obtain
  • Bachelors' degree preferred
